- W2578603188 abstract "Mobile advertisement distribution effects are vitally important for advertisers as well as users. Status quo studies are lacking of efficient distribution especially when user traces and budgets are involved. In achieving efficient and effective mobile advertisement applications, this work advocates the concept of location-centric mobile crowdsourcing network instead of conventional user-centric and platform, where locations are vitally important for advertisement distribution. To this end, this work focuses on the mobile advertisement user selection problem when interested area coverage (IAC) is considered. Unfortunately, developing location-centric needs to deal with the spatio-temporal features in each user, and IAC coverage needs to be effectively counted. Even worse, budget constraint makes this problem intractable. In tackling aforementioned challenges, this work makes following efforts: First, a budget-constrained user selection problem is formulated when location sensitive mobile advertisement applications are considered, which is proved to be NP-hard. Second, the submodularity feature is explored, and a simple but efficient heuristic algorithm is presented with guaranteed approximation ratio (1-1/e). Finally, extensive simulation results show that, our scheme could effectively improve the propagation effects for mobile advertisement with 125%." @default.
